阿里云CDN播放視頻協(xié)議詳解(視頻流媒體介紹技術實現(xiàn)原理)
阿里云CDN是一種全球范圍內的內容分發(fā)網絡,它可以將網站內容快速傳輸?shù)饺蚋鞯兀褂谜呖梢栽谌魏蔚胤讲シ乓曨l,而不受網絡環(huán)境的限制。本文將詳細介紹阿里云CDN播放視頻的優(yōu)勢和協(xié)議,以及如何使用它來提高視頻播放的性能。
一、阿里云CDN播放視頻的優(yōu)勢
阿里云CDN是一種分布式內容分發(fā)網絡,可以將網站內容快速傳輸?shù)饺蚋鞯?,使用者可以在任何地方播放視頻,而不受網絡環(huán)境的限制。
阿里云CDN播放視頻的優(yōu)勢有:
- 1. 全球范圍內的覆蓋:阿里云CDN覆蓋全球超過200個和地區(qū),可以將視頻內容快速傳輸?shù)饺蚋鞯兀褂谜呖梢栽谌魏蔚胤讲シ乓曨l,而不受網絡環(huán)境的限制。
- 2. 支持多種視頻格式:阿里云CDN支持多種視頻格式,包括MP4、FLV、HLS等,可以滿足不同設備和瀏覽器的播放需求。
- 3. 高效緩存:阿里云CDN可以將視頻內容緩存在全球各地的節(jié)點上,使用者可以從近的節(jié)點獲取視頻內容,提高視頻播放的速度和流暢度。
- 4. 安全可靠:阿里云CDN提供多種安全防護措施,可以有效防止視頻內容被篡改或泄露,保障視頻內容的安全。
二、阿里云CDN播放視頻的協(xié)議
ingegamicing over HTTP(DASH)等。其中,HLS是一種基于HTTP的流媒體傳輸協(xié)議,它可以將視頻流分割成多個小片段,并將這些小片段以HTTP協(xié)議傳輸?shù)娇蛻舳?,客戶端收到小片段后再將其組裝成完整的視頻流,從而提高視頻播放的流暢度和延遲。
RTMP是一種實時流媒體傳輸協(xié)議,它可以將視頻流以實時的方式傳輸?shù)娇蛻舳?,從而提高視頻播放的流暢度和延遲。
DASH是一種基于HTTP的動態(tài)自適應流媒體協(xié)議,它可以根據(jù)客戶端的網絡環(huán)境自動調整視頻流的清晰度和碼率,從而提高視頻播放的流暢度和延遲。
三、如何使用阿里云CDN播放視頻
使用阿里云CDN播放視頻需要完成以下步驟:
- 1. 準備視頻內容:首先需要準備好要播放的視頻內容,包括視頻文件、視頻封面圖片等。
- 2. 上傳視頻:將視頻文件上傳到阿里云CDN,并配置視頻封面圖片。
- 3. 生成播放地址:根據(jù)上傳的視頻文件,生成播放地址,可以支持HLS、RTMP、DASH等多種播放協(xié)議。
- 4. 嵌入播放器:將生成的播放地址嵌入到網頁中,可以使用HTML5的
<video>
標簽或者第三方的播放器插件。 - 5. 播放視頻:訪問網頁,即可播放視頻。
四、總結
阿里云CDN是一種全球范圍內的內容分發(fā)網絡,它可以將網站內容快速傳輸?shù)饺蚋鞯兀褂谜呖梢栽谌魏蔚胤讲シ乓曨l,而不受網絡環(huán)境的限制。阿里云CDN支持多種視頻播放協(xié)議,可以滿足不同設備和瀏覽器的播放需求,并且提供多種安全防護措施,可以有效防止視頻內容被篡改或泄露,保障視頻內容的安全。使用阿里云CDN播放視頻可以提高視頻播放的性能,提升用戶體驗。